Mar 19/10 - The Medicine Hat Police Service will be losing one of its long-time members in a couple of weeks. Chief Andy McGrogan says Constable Barry Steier, the alleged victim of a high-profile attack in mid-January, will be leaving soon. He says Steier is out of hospital and recovering well, having visited a few times, but with some lingering problems he's decided to retire, effective April 1st. McGrogan calls Steier a "good patrolman" and will be missed. Steier's wife, Shauna, faces charges including attempted murder and will be back in court later this month.
